/// <summary> /// Runs the task. /// </summary> /// <remarks> /// This autoincrements assembly verions. /// </remarks> /// <returns><c>true</c> if the task completed successfully; /// <c>false</c> otherwise.</returns> public override bool Execute() { List<AssemblyInfo> lstFilesToSave = new List<AssemblyInfo>(); foreach (ITaskItem titAssemblyInfoFile in AssemblyInfoFiles) { string strInfoFilePath = titAssemblyInfoFile.ItemSpec; if (!File.Exists(strInfoFilePath)) { Log.LogError("Assembly Version Auto Increment", null, null, strInfoFilePath, 0, 0, 0, 0, "Unable to find Assembly Info File."); return false; } AssemblyInfo asiInfo = new AssemblyInfo(strInfoFilePath); if (asiInfo.AssemblyVersion.Split('.').Length != 2) { Log.LogError("Assembly Version Auto Increment", null, null, strInfoFilePath, asiInfo.AssemblyVersionLine, asiInfo.AssemblyVersionColumn, asiInfo.AssemblyVersionLine, asiInfo.AssemblyVersionColumn + asiInfo.AssemblyVersion.Length, "AssemblyVersion is not in Major.Minor form (Build and Revision are not allowed)."); return false; } DateTime dteEpoch = new DateTime(2000, 01, 01, 00, 00, 00, DateTimeKind.Utc); Int32 intDaysSinceEpoch = (Int32)DateTime.UtcNow.Subtract(dteEpoch).TotalDays; DateTime dteMidnight = DateTime.UtcNow; dteMidnight = new DateTime(dteMidnight.Year, dteMidnight.Month, dteMidnight.Day, 0, 0, 0, DateTimeKind.Utc); Int32 intBiSecondsSinceMidnight = (Int32)DateTime.UtcNow.Subtract(dteMidnight).TotalSeconds / 2; if (String.IsNullOrEmpty(asiInfo.AssemblyFileVersionFormat)) { Log.LogError("Assembly Version Auto Increment", null, null, strInfoFilePath, 0, 0, 0, 0, "AssemblyFileVersionFormat not found."); return false; } //Log.LogMessage("Setting AsseblyVersion: {0}", asiInfo.AssemblyVersion); string strAssemblyFileVersionFormat = null; switch (asiInfo.AssemblyFileVersionFormat.Split('.').Length) { case 0: case 1: case 2: Log.LogError("Assembly Version Auto Increment", null, null, strInfoFilePath, 0, 0, 0, 0, "AssemblyFileVersionFormat must be 1.1.* or 1.1.1.*"); return false; case 3: strAssemblyFileVersionFormat = "{0}.{1}.{2}"; break; case 4: strAssemblyFileVersionFormat = "{0}.{2}"; lstFilesToSave.Add(asiInfo); break; } asiInfo.AssemblyFileVersion = String.Format(strAssemblyFileVersionFormat, asiInfo.AssemblyVersion, intDaysSinceEpoch, intBiSecondsSinceMidnight); lstFilesToSave.Add(asiInfo); Log.LogMessage("Setting AsseblyFileVersion: {0}", asiInfo.AssemblyFileVersion); } foreach (AssemblyInfo asiInfo in lstFilesToSave) { string strTempFile = Path.GetTempFileName(); File.WriteAllText(strTempFile, asiInfo.GenerateFile()); File.Copy(strTempFile, asiInfo.FilePath, true); File.Delete(strTempFile); } return true; }
